Transaction 07cf1073e52cc8afafcffe74453061531469cfac9d48cd2fd508023aa1c6953c
2 Input
2 Outputs
- 07cf1073e52cc8afafcffe74453061531469cfac9d48cd2fd508023aa1c6953c:0
- 07cf1073e52cc8afafcffe74453061531469cfac9d48cd2fd508023aa1c6953c:1
value 50630
address 1BTHAVmiRXXHQyewBFArTPadhPTpE6dDQD
value 580878
address 34CrYZ8XuLGEaJ885C54nLYM5K53NtoTRR